Output a3a609b1a1330c087391c264ae75f1d4c05cf2d81dc4254f26563c3018c1190e:1

value
1341538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89f4086860bc9e585a748e384ae3ab9b252e167b OP_EQUAL
address
MLUb9Qjtf2UsKnjzsqVa9yBbFTdf13niws
transaction
a3a609b1a1330c087391c264ae75f1d4c05cf2d81dc4254f26563c3018c1190e
spent
true